Introduction

We are a blank check company incorporated in the British Virgin Islands as a business company with limited liability (meaning that our shareholders have no liability, as members of our company, for the liabilities of our company over and above the amount already paid for their shares) and formed for the purpose of acquiring, engaging in a share exchange, share reconstruction and amalgamation with, purchasing all or substantially all of the assets of, entering into contractual arrangements with, or engaging in any other similar business combination with one or more businesses or entities, which we refer to throughout this Report as our initial business combination.

Business Strategy

Our efforts in identifying prospective target businesses are not be limited to a particular industry or country, including but not limited to businesses that have their primary operations located in the Asia-pacific region (“Asia-pacific” or “Asia”). We believe that we will add value to these businesses primarily by providing them with access to the U.S. capital markets.

We seek to capitalize on the strength of our management team. Our team consists of experienced financial services and accounting professionals, senior operating executives, and managers of Asian and U.S. companies. Our independent directors have collective experience in entrepreneurship, asset management/advisory services, and accounting & tax practices in mainland China, Hong Kong and the U.S, as well as knowledge of sectors and industries arising in connection with provision of those services and entrepreneurial experiences. We believe we benefit from their accomplishments, and specifically their current activities in the Asian market, in identifying attractive acquisition opportunities. However, the past performance of our management team, advisors and their affiliates is not a guarantee either of (i) success of any business combination we may consummate or (ii) that we will complete a business combination.

Our officers and directors, or our “management team,” has a broad range of collective operational experience across a variety of economic sectors, including corporate financing, debt financing, internet, real estate, insurance, health care, energy and resources, consumer and retail, manufacturing, capital markets and information technology. Our acquisition strategy leverages our team’s relationships as well as relationships with management teams of public and private companies, investment bankers, attorneys and accountants, which we should provide us with a number of potential target businesses with which we may consummate an initial business combination.

We deploy a pro-active, thematic sourcing strategy and focus on companies for which we believe the combination of our relationships, capital and capital markets expertise and operating experience of executives at Shanghai Ning Sheng Supply Chain Group Co. Ltd., or “Ning Sheng Group Co.”, our sponsor’s 100% parent company, can help accelerate the target business’ growth and performance.
